Vespene Energy - renewable Bitcoin mining

Vespene Energy is a Berkeley, CA based company focused on the intersection of Bitcoin, Climate and Energy. The company can be viewed as a methane mitigation company, a low energy cost Bitcoin mining company, and a long term renewable energy infrastructure developer. Vespene utilizes micro-turbines installed at municipal landfills to convert excess or wasted methane gas into electricity which is then fed to bitcoin mining data centers. Vespene's immediately deployable, and highly scalable technology, enables municipal landfill operators to monetize an otherwise stranded asset while reducing harmful greenhouse gas emissions. As Vespene provides this infrastructure, the municipalities have a completely hands-off experience which enables a completely new revenue stream with zero cost to the municipality.

Their goal is to mitigate a major source of greenhouse gas emissions and help fuel the transition to a renewable energy future by using bitcoin mining to turn landfill methane streams into revenue streams for their customers. Their sites require no connection to the grid or pipeline buildout. They can turn otherwise harmful and wasted landfill methane into a clean power source for carbon-negative Bitcoin mining in about six months. Furthermore, the unique structure Vespene offers actually incentivizes local governments to learn more about bitcoin and the mining process.

Vespene's unique approach enables landfill operators to get ahead of pending EPA (Environment Protection Agency) mandates to reduce methane emissions – one Vespene module will eliminate 270,000 metric tons of CO2-equivalent per year – while Bitcoin mining provides a near-term revenue stream that serves as a bridge to eventually power on-site vehicle charging, fleet electrification, and grid-interconnection. Bitcoin mining depends on access to large amounts of inexpensive sources of energy. By using wasted methane to power Bitcoin mining, Vespene is killing two birds with one stone – mitigating harmful GHG emissions and helping transition Bitcoin mining toward carbon-neutral and carbon-negative energy sources.

Adam Wright is the co-founder and CEO of Vespene Energy. Vespene Energy has raised a total of $4.3M in funding.
